The Mystery Ranch Family Tree

The Ranchero story started with the Bozeman, which was a limited-edition backpack that served as the two brands’ first joint project. By 2025 it had graduated into a permanent fixture of YETI’s catalog under the Ranchero name. The pack spanned 12 to 27 liters and carryied over Mystery Ranch’s beloved three-zip opening.

The Crossbody is the first Ranchero to break from that template. At 4 liters (or a truly tiny 1 liter), there’s simply no room for a triple zipper. So YETI decided to get creative.

Magnets Over Zippers

Instead of a zipper, the main opening relies on fabric-encased chain magnets running the full length of the mouth. Tug the pull tab and the whole thing yawns open for one-handed access. Let go, and it snaps shut on its own.

Now, magnetic closures on slings aren’t new, but running them across the entire opening rather than a single point is a clever bit of engineering.

Small Bag, Same Bones

Shrinking the silhouette didn’t mean cheapening the build. The shell is abrasion-resistant 700D Cordura nylon, the base gets a heavy-duty 840D nylon with a TPU coating, and the interior is lined in 210D ripstop.

Inside, you’ll find a spread of organizer pockets, a key leash, and enough room in the 4L to swallow an 18oz Rambler bottle. A 38mm webbing strap lets it ride crossbody or around the hips, and the hook-and-loop panel up front accepts YETI’s collector patches, if that’s your thing.

Spec Sheet

Brand: YETI
Model: Ranchero Crossbody
Sizes: 4L & 1L
Dimensions (4L): 11.4″W x 3.0″D x 7.1″H
Dimensions (1L): 9.4″W x 2.6″D x 5.5″H
Weight: 0.8 lbs (4L) / 0.7 lbs (1L)
Shell: 700D Cordura nylon
Base: 840D nylon with TPU coating
Liner: 210D nylon ripstop
Closure: Full-length encased chain magnets
Strap: 38mm adjustable webbing
Warranty: 3 years

Pricing & Availability

The Ranchero Crossbody is available now in Olive, Dusk, Black, and rotating seasonal colorways, priced at $115 for the 4L and $95 for the 1L.
